You can create assemblies that are precise and reference a speci fic revision of each
component; you can also create dynamic assemblies in which current revision rule
determines the con figuration of the assembly. Dynamic assemblies are sometimes
referred to as imprecise assemblies. The hierarchical structure relationship between
the immediate parent assembly and its child component item or item revision
in a precise assembly is represented by an occurrence (sometimes called relative
occurrence). For more information about precise and imprecise assemblies, see
chapter 2, Building and Maintaining Product Structure.
You can de fine sophisticated revision rules that allow you to con figure the structure
in different ways. This allows you to create a single structure and reuse it many
times, for example, for different versions of the product. Revision con figuration
depends on the release status of an item revision, and its related effective date,
effective unit number, or the release date. It allows you to reproduce a con figuration
that was effective at a certain date in the past or recreate the con figuration of
a speci fic unit. For more information about using revision rules, see chapter 5,
Con figuring Product Structure With Revisions.
